WHAT IS MORTGAGE
Mortgage is a type of loan which is used to purchase a home and mortgage is offered by credit unions, banks, other financial institutions. When you try to purchase any house using mortgage, your lender or bank loaning you the funds —actually pays for the home outright. Then, over the length of your loan, you pay the lender back for those funds + interest, month after month.
When you are buying a home using mortgage, you will make regular monthly payments until balance clear. Your payments can cover several costs, including Principal, Interest, Homeowners insurance, Taxes and Mortgage insurance points on a mortgage
WHAT IS PROS AND CONS OF ADJUSTABLE AND FIXED RATE
Pros of adjustable rate are: 1. Lower monthly payment, initially 2. Lower interest rates, initially 3. Good for short-term homeowners 4. Higher debt-to-income allowed. Cons of adjustable rate are: 1. Unpredictable payments after a certain point 2. Risk of an interest-rate increase later on 3.Risky for long-term homeowners. Pros of Fixed rate are: 1. Predictable monthly payments 2. No risk of an interest rate increase 3. Good for long-term homeowners 4. Easy to budget and plan for. Cons of Fixed rate are: 1. May be harder to afford the home you want 2. Higher interest rates, at least initially.
WHAT IS MORTGAGE INSURANCE
Mortgage insurance is a type of insurance policy designed to protect mortgage lenders. If a borrower defaults on their mortgage loan, mortgage insurance steps in and pays off all or a portion of the outstanding balance. On Federal Housing Association (FHA) mortgage loans, this type of insurance, commonly referred to as MIP, is required for all borrowers.
